Transaction e23c63e63ee02d720a3cfebfacba425d28e4a5ac7c375effb3338c43f155abc1
1 Input
1 Output
-
e23c63e63ee02d720a3cfebfacba425d28e4a5ac7c375effb3338c43f155abc1:0
- value
- 468742
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c9b8d92671fe66b7a20ac6620086445cf85984c OP_EQUALVERIFY OP_CHECKSIG
- address
- 13cGGPHXeLwMfP2sChMCZ6ayQ2fnrveXRX